    Langeoog is one of Germany’s East Frisian Islands located in the North Sea. Langeoog is known for it’s long beaches, seaside village, and relaxed atmosphere. Langeoog can be reached by ferry but keep in mind that vehicles are not allowed on the island. The best way to explore the island is by foot, bike, or taking a horse-drawn carriage. When…
